Several NATO allies are calling for the alliance to coordinate its approach in Greenland. Italy's defense minister, Guido Crosetto, said NATO needs to unite, not divide, on the issue, while Estonia's Prime Minister Kaja Kallas warned against excessive pessimism about NATO's future amid the tensions.
Denmark has warned that a forced U.S. takeover of Greenland would mean the end of NATO. Meanwhile, other European Union and NATO members have expressed support for Greenland's position as strategic competition in the Arctic increases.
